MORAVIAN’S GRIMES & RILEY TO LANDMARK MEN’S SOCCER ALL-CONFERENCE SECOND TEAM

MADISON, NJ --- Senior defender Gary Grimes (Wall, NJ/Christian Brothers Academy HS) and freshman midfielder Hugh Riley (Tinton Falls, NJ/Monmouth Regional HS) of the Moravian College men’s soccer team have been named to the 2010 Landmark Men’s Soccer All-Conference Second Team announced Monday.

The duo helped the Greyhounds to a 5-12-1 record this season including two wins by shutout and a 3-3-1 mark in the Landmark Conference regular season. 

Grimes, who was on the Landmark All-Conference Second Team in 2008 before missing all of 2009 with an injury, had a goal and an assist for three points this season.  Grimes, pictured at top right, had five goals and five assists for 15 points in 57 career matches for Moravian.

Riley, pictured at left, was Moravian’s leading scorer in his debut season with six goals and two assists for 14 points.  He had a pair of game-winning goals as well as a two-goal match in a 3-1 win at Goucher College.
